Understanding What a Dog Runner Is

A dog runner is essentially a long leash or tether that allows your dog to roam freely within a safe distance without the risk of running off. For big dogs, this means something sturdy and reliable because they have more strength and energy.

Why Size and Strength Matter

With my large dog, durability was my top priority. I looked for materials like heavy-duty nylon or thick, braided rope that could withstand pulling and rough play. Thin or weak runners simply won’t hold up and could snap, which isn’t safe for either of us.

Length of the Runner

I found that the length depends on where I was planning to use it. For backyard use, a 15-30 foot runner gave my dog enough space to explore but kept him close. If you’re using it for hiking or open areas, longer runners (up to 50 feet) offer more freedom but require more supervision.

Attachment and Safety Features

A secure, heavy-duty clasp is essential. My dog’s runner needed a strong carabiner or metal clip that could attach firmly to his harness without risk of coming loose. I also liked runners with reflective stitching for visibility during early morning or evening walks.

Comfort for Your Dog

Big dogs can sometimes get tangled or hurt if the runner is too heavy or abrasive. I made sure to pick a runner with smooth edges and a comfortable handle for myself since I often hold the runner directly. Padded handles helped me avoid hand strain during long walks.

Portability and Storage

Since I take my dog to different parks and trails, having a runner that is easy to coil and store was a bonus. Some runners come with storage bags or reels, which can be very convenient when you’re on the go.

Additional Tips From My Experience

  • Always pair the runner with a sturdy harness rather than just a collar to avoid neck injuries.
  • Check for any signs of wear and tear regularly to keep your dog safe.
  • Practice using the runner in a controlled environment before letting your dog off-leash in a new place.
  • Consider your dog’s temperament—if they are very strong pullers or excitable, invest in a thicker, more robust runner.
